What should I check when buying a used campervan or motorhome in Dorset?

When buying a used campervan or motorhome, thoroughly inspect the vehicle for signs of damp or water damage, especially around windows, seams, and the roof. Check the condition of the tyres, battery, and engine. Ensure all appliances, such as the fridge, hob, and water heater, are functioning correctly. Obtain a vehicle history check to verify mileage and uncover any previous accidents or outstanding finance.

What legal requirements should I be aware of when buying a campervan or motorhome in the UK?

Ensure the campervan or motorhome has a valid MOT certificate. Check the vehicle's V5C registration document (log book) to confirm the seller is the registered keeper. Verify the vehicle's weight and ensure you have the appropriate driving licence. Be aware of any road tax implications based on the vehicle's emissions and age. It's wise to have a professional inspection carried out before completing the purchase.

What are some common issues to look for in older campervans and motorhomes?

Older campervans and motorhomes are prone to issues like corrosion, particularly underneath the vehicle and around wheel arches. Check for rust and signs of repair. Inspect the condition of the interior upholstery and fittings, looking for wear and tear. Also, be mindful of the age of the gas and electrical systems and ensure they have been regularly serviced.

What safety features should I prioritise when buying a campervan or motorhome?

Ensure the campervan or motorhome has working smoke and carbon monoxide detectors. Check the condition of the seatbelts and ensure they are functioning correctly. Verify that the gas system is safe and leak-free. Consider vehicles with modern safety features like ABS brakes and airbags. It's also advisable to have a fire extinguisher and fire blanket readily accessible.

What questions should I ask the seller before buying a campervan or motorhome?

Ask about the vehicle's service history, including any recent repairs or maintenance. Enquire about the reason for selling. Ask if the vehicle has ever been involved in an accident. Clarify whether all appliances are in working order and if there are any known issues with the vehicle. Request to see any relevant documentation, such as service records and warranty information. Inquire about the vehicle's gas safety certificate.
